Home Heating System Maintenance Filter and Separator Tips

Home Heating System Maintenance Filter and Separator Tips

2026-02-27

As winter's chill sets in, heating systems become essential guardians of household comfort. Yet beneath this warmth lurks an invisible threat—corrosion—that silently degrades system efficiency and longevity.

The Hidden Dangers of Corrosion

Corrosion manifests in multiple forms within heating systems, each posing distinct challenges:

  • Iron Oxide: Forms when iron reacts with oxygen and water, circulating through systems to accelerate wear, clog pipes, and reduce thermal efficiency.
  • Mineral Scale: Calcium and magnesium deposits that insulate heat exchangers, significantly impairing heat transfer.
  • Sediment: Particulate matter that abrades components and obstructs water flow.
System Impacts

Corrosive elements collectively:

  • Decrease thermal efficiency by 15-30%, increasing energy consumption
  • Obstruct piping and sensitive components
  • Shorten equipment lifespan through progressive degradation
  • Compromise sensor accuracy and system control
  • Generate disruptive operational noise
Filtration Solutions

Modern filtration technologies address these challenges through specialized approaches:

1. Magnetic Filters

High-strength magnets capture ferrous particles, particularly effective for:

  • High-efficiency boiler systems
  • Installations with cast iron radiators
2. Sediment Separators

Mechanical filtration removes suspended solids through:

  • Gravity separation chambers
  • Screen filtration mechanisms
3. Combination Air/Dirt Eliminators

Integrated systems address both gaseous and particulate contaminants using centrifugal separation principles.

Selection Criteria

Optimal filtration requires evaluation of:

  • System configuration and materials
  • Water quality parameters
  • Flow rate compatibility
  • Pressure and temperature ratings
  • Maintenance requirements
Implementation Considerations

Proper installation and maintenance protocols include:

  • Professional installation by HVAC technicians
  • Regular cleaning cycles (monthly for magnetic units)
  • Annual comprehensive inspections
Economic Rationale

Filtration investments yield measurable returns through:

  • 5-15% reduction in energy consumption
  • Extended equipment service life (2-5 years)
  • Decreased maintenance frequency and costs
